Job Description
The Director of Food & Beverage is a key member of the club's leadership team, responsible for creating exceptional dining and social experiences that enhance member satisfaction and engagement. This role provides strategic leadership for all front-of-house food and beverage operations, ensuring service excellence, innovative programming, strong team development, and sustainable financial success. Reporting directly to the General Manager, the Director of Food & Beverage oversees all dining venues, banquet services, special events, and beverage operations. Working in close partnership with the Executive Chef, this leader ensures a seamless and elevated member experience across all food and beverage offerings. While culinary production and kitchen operations are managed by the Executive Chef, the Director focuses on operational execution, service standards, member relations, and the overall performance of the department. The successful candidate will inspire and develop high-performing teams, foster a culture of hospitality and accountability, and champion continuous improvement. This is an exceptional opportunity for a hospitality professional who is passionate about service excellence, team leadership, and creating memorable experiences for members and guests while driving operational and financial results.
- Serve as a highly visible leader who sets the tone for service excellence, actively guiding operations and supporting teams during peak business periods, member functions, and signature club events.
- Foster a positive work environment through effective team leadership and staff development initiatives.
- Collaborate with the Executive Chef on menu planning, food presentation, seasonal updates, and member dining feedback.
- Manage financial performance of the F&B department: budget development, forecasting, inventory controls, labor cost management, and P&L accountability.
- Work closely with the Events team to coordinate and execute member events, Club functions, and tournaments.
- Monitor member feedback and implement strategies for continuous service improvement.
- Maintain compliance with health, safety, and sanitation regulations.
- Serve as a visible and engaging presence during service hours and events.
- Manage kitchen staff and front-of-house teams to ensure seamless service delivery during peak times.
- Participate in leadership meetings and provide regular updates to the General Manager and Board as needed.
- Ensure excellence in member satisfaction through quality food, attentive service, and overall ambiance.
- Develop and implement food and beverage policies, procedures, and service standards that align with the Club’s mission and values.
- Oversee hiring, training, scheduling, and development of all F&B staff
